Are you a passionate and experienced Care Manager ready to lead with purpose in a values-driven aged care organisation? Respect Aged Care is currently seeking a committed Registered Nurse to take on a shared Care Manager role across our Avonlea and Coates homes. This is a full-time position (76 hours per fortnight), working Monday to Friday, with flexibility to support operational needs where required.
This unique opportunity will see you working 5 days per fortnight at Avonlea and 5 days per fortnight at Coates. The successful candidate will be allocated a base home (based on residential location), with travel reimbursement provided when working at the alternate site.

The Opportunity
The Care Manager plays a critical leadership role in delivering clinical and operational excellence across two homes. Reporting to the General Manager, this role is responsible for:
Planning, allocating, delegating and overseeing resident care delivery in accordance with clinical best practice
Ensuring compliance with Aged Care Quality Standards, clinical policies, and legislative requirements
Leading, mentoring and supporting nursing and care teams to deliver excellence in care
Overseeing care planning, documentation, assessments and funding requirements
Contributing to accreditation processes, audits and continuous improvement initiatives
Supporting effective resource management, including staffing and budget considerations
Fostering a positive, collaborative team environment across both sites
You will play a pivotal role in strengthening clinical governance, driving quality outcomes, and supporting teams to deliver person-centred care.
